网站代码优化是提高网站性能、加载速度和用户体验的重要步骤。以下是一些优化方法:
1. 减少HTTP请求
- 合并文件:将多个CSS和JavaScript文件合并成一个文件,减少请求次数。
- 使用CSS Sprites:将多个小图标合并成一张大图,通过CSS背景定位显示。
2. 压缩文件
- 启用Gzip压缩:对HTML、CSS和JavaScript文件进行Gzip压缩,减小文件大小。
- 使用CSS和JavaScript压缩工具:利用工具如UglifyJS和CSSNano等来压缩代码,去除空格和注释。
3. 使用异步加载
- 异步加载JavaScript:使用`async`和`defer`属性以非阻塞方式加载JavaScript文件,优化页面渲染速度。
4. 资源优化
- 图像优化:使用合适的图像格式(如JPEG、PNG、WebP),并压缩图像文件。
- 懒加载图像:仅在用户滚动到特定区域时加载图像,减少初始加载时间。
5. 目录结构优化
- 简化文件和文件夹结构:合理组织目录结构,保证访问路径短而清晰,增强可读性和可维护性。
6. CDN(内容分发网络)
- 使用CDN:将静态资源托管在CDN上,以提高加载速度并减轻服务器负担。
7. 优化数据库查询
- 索引数据库:确保数据库中使用索引,以提高查询效率。
- 减少查询次数:优化代码以减少不必要的数据库查询。
8. 使用缓存
- 浏览器缓存:设置合理的缓存策略,让浏览器缓存静态文件。
- 服务器端缓存:使用缓存技术(如Redis、Memcached)存储常用数据,减少数据库访问。
9. 代码优化
- 消除冗余代码:去除不必要的代码段和函数,减少代码复杂度。
- 使用现代JavaScript特性:如Promise、async/await来提高代码执行效率。
10. 定期监测和测试
- 使用性能监测工具:如Google PageSpeed Insights、GTmetrix等,定期检查网站性能并优化。
- A/B测试:尝试不同的优化方案,分析其对用户体验和加载速度的影响。
通过这些方法的综合应用,可以显著提升网站的性能和用户体验。在优化网站代码的过程中,应根据具体情况逐步实施,并持续监控和调整。
查看详情
查看详情